Comparable Facts
Compare California State University Chico in Chico, CA with Simpson University in Redding, CA on tuition, admissions, graduation, earnings, and student body data using the table above.
California State University Chico is larger than Simpson University based on total student enrollment (15,257 students vs. 992 students)
Location, institution type, and student-faculty ratio
- California State University Chico is located in Chico, CA (Small City setting); Simpson University is in Redding, CA (Rural Fringe setting).
- California State University Chico is a public, non-profit 4-year institution. Simpson University is a private, non-profit 4-year institution.
- Student-to-faculty ratio: California State University Chico 23:1; Simpson University 17:1.
CSU vs. Simpson University Cost Comparison
Which college is more expensive, CSU or Simpson University?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).
- The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at California State University Chico than Simpson University ($14,630 vs. $28,653).
-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Simpson University are 27.9% lower than at California State University Chico ($11,900 vs. $16,500).
- Simpson University is 368.7% more expensive for in-state tuition than CSU (about $31,236 more per year; $39,708.00 vs. $8,472.00).
- Out-of-state tuition is 88.4% higher at Simpson University than at California State University Chico (about $18,636 more per year; $39,708.00 vs. $21,072.00).
- A larger share of students receive grant aid at Simpson University than at California State University Chico (100% vs. 66%).
- The average total grant financial aid received by Simpson University students is 125.4% larger than aid received by California State University Chico students ($25,937 vs. $11,509).
CSU vs. Simpson University Admissions comparison
Which college is harder to get into, CSU or Simpson University? Typical SAT and ACT scores (same estimates as in the table above), middle 50% test ranges where reported, test score submission policy, deadlines, and acceptance rates summarize admission difficulty between Simpson University and CSU.
- The typical SAT score (median estimate) at California State University Chico (1070) is the same as at Simpson University (1070).
- Incoming Simpson University students have a 3 point higher typical ACT composite (median estimate) (24 vs. 21 at CSU).
- Reported middle 50% SAT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: California State University Chico 970/1170; Simpson University 960/1185.
- Reported middle 50% ACT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: California State University Chico 18/24; Simpson University 21/28.
- Submitting SAT or ACT scores: CSU - Test-free; Simpson University - Test-free.
- Typical fall application deadline: CSU Dec 15, 2026; Simpson University Aug 1, 2027.
- Accepted freshman Simpson University students have a 0.03 point higher average high school GPA (3.4) than students at CSU (3.37).
- CSU has a higher acceptance rate (92.7%) than Simpson University (86%).
- The share of admitted students who enrolled (yield) is 10.2% at CSU vs. 24.2% at Simpson University.
CSU vs. Simpson University Graduation Outcomes Comparison
How do outcomes compare for CSU and Simpson University?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).
- California State University Chico's six-year graduation rate (59%) is higher than Simpson University's (43%).
- Graduates from California State University Chico earn a median of about $14,200 more per year than Simpson University graduates about ten years after starting college ($52,400 vs. $38,200),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
- Among federal student loan borrowers, Simpson University graduates have a $332 lower median loan debt than CSU graduates ($16,668 vs. $17,000).
- Among borrowers, Simpson University graduates have an estimated $3 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than CSU graduates ($172 vs. $175).
- More CSU gra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Simpson University students, three years after graduation. (70% vs. 67%)
